Problem
Current treatments for obsessive-compulsive disorder (OCD) are inadequate for a significant portion of patients, and the underlying pathophysiology remains unclear, with existing therapies showing limited efficacy and high rates of treatment resistance.
Innovation Solution
A multi-strain probiotic formulation comprising Bacillus coagulans, Lactobacillus rhamnosus, Bifidobacterium lactis, Lactobacillus plantarum, Bifidobacterium breve, and Bifidobacterium infantis, along with glutamine, is administered to modulate the gut microbiome, producing GABA and addressing neurotransmitter imbalances to alleviate OCD symptoms.

A method of treating, preventing or ameliorating at least one symptom of obsessive compulsive disorder (OCD) in a subject is disclosed. The method comprises a step in which a multistrain probiotic formulation is administered to the subject. The multistrain probiotic formulation includes the bacterial strains Bacillus coagulans, Lactobacillus rhamnosus, Bifidobacterium lactis, Lactobacillus plantarum, Bifidobacterium breve and Bifidobacterium infantis and Glutamine in a concentration range of 100-500 mg.
